| Yo bois and gurrls. Do you know about WhatPulse? Been pulsing since 2010 and it's fun. Basically it counts the keys you've pressed, counts the clicks, the total download and upload and total uptime. (It also shows it for each individual application) There are ranks and also there are teams you can join and compete against other teams. | I've seen a sneak preview for the v3.0 client and it looks fire! It will also use npcap instead of winpcap, which is far more stable. The latter hasn't been updated for a very long time. | |
